Career path

Career Role Description
Advanced Automation Engineer (Robotics & AI) Design, implement, and maintain robotic systems and AI-powered automation solutions for manufacturing processes. High demand for expertise in PLC programming and robotic integration.
Automation & Robotics Technician Install, troubleshoot, and maintain automated manufacturing equipment including robots, PLCs, and control systems. Strong practical skills and problem-solving abilities are essential.
Manufacturing Process Automation Specialist Analyze manufacturing processes, identify areas for automation, and implement solutions to improve efficiency and productivity. Experience in Lean Manufacturing principles is highly valued.
AI/ML Engineer (Manufacturing) Develop and implement AI and machine learning algorithms for predictive maintenance, quality control, and process optimization in advanced manufacturing settings. Expertise in data analysis and model deployment is critical.
